NCRA Recruitment 2024 33 Work Assistant Posts; Apply Here!

NCRA invites online applications from the citizens of India for recruitment of 33 Work Assistant Posts. Applicants are required to apply Online through NCRA Website, i.e., http://www.ncra.tifr.res.in/ (Recruitment Section) from 27.06.2024 to 21.07.2024. Candidates should go through the NCRA Work Assistant Recruitment Notice 2024 carefully before applying for the post and ensure that they fulfill all the eligibility conditions.
